机制MySQL容错能力:实现更可靠的数据库系统(mysql容错)
MySQL是使用最广泛的关系型数据库管理系统,其可靠性要求很高。为了确保数据完整性、有效性和一致性,MySQL实现了强大的容错机制,以有效地对应潜在的硬件故障、网络中断等相关问题。下面,让我们来看一看MySQL在容错能力方面的实现,以实现更可靠的数据库系统。
首先,MySQL使用存储引擎取代传统的文件结构,使用基于文件的存储引擎,可以保证数据在硬盘上更加安全可靠。此外,MySQL引入了崩溃恢复机制,可以识别数据的崩溃,并自动恢复崩溃后的数据,从而节省了开发者们的时间,并有助于保护数据库的完整性。
其次,MySQL提供了可靠的备份机制。使用它可以在数据崩溃后进行简单的文件备份恢复,以确保数据的完整性和一致性。此外,MySQL还引入了一种新的备份机制——异步复制,即将数据的更新同步到多台服务器中,既可以提高系统性能,又可以有效地避免数据丢失或损坏。
另外,MySQL也为数据库提供了强大的安全机制,以保护数据不受破坏。除了传统的数据安全技术外,MySQL还支持访问控制、审计和智能加密机制,可以有效防止数据泄露和损坏。
总之,MySQL旨在通过它的强大容错机制来支持更可靠的数据库系统。它支持存储引擎取代传统的文件结构,引入自动崩溃恢复机制,支持文件备份和异步复制,以及提供强大的安全机制,使其成为最可靠的数据库管理系统。